All you need to know about root

-A A +A

What is the root of Android?

In the context of Android, "root" refers to having privileged access or administrative control over the operating system. It is similar to the concept of "root" or "administrator" access on a computer.

When you root an Android device, it means that you have obtained access to the root user account, which has elevated permissions beyond those of a standard user.

How to unlock the bootloader and OEM?

root samsung android. what is root?

Rooting an Android device allows you to make changes and modifications that are otherwise restricted by the manufacturer or the operating system.

This includes installing custom firmware (ROMs), removing pre-installed bloatware, accessing system files, and using apps that require root access.

Rooting can provide benefits such as the ability to customize the device's appearance and behavior, improve performance, and install apps that require root access. However, it also carries certain risks. 

By gaining root access, you bypass some of the built-in security measures of the Android system, potentially exposing your device to security vulnerabilities or malware if you're not cautious.

It's important to note that rooting an Android device usually voids its warranty, and it can also cause issues with certain apps or services that rely on the device's security measures.

Therefore, it's recommended to thoroughly research the process, understand the potential risks and benefits, and proceed with caution if you decide to root your Android device.

Benefits of Rooting Android

Rooting an Android device can offer a multitude of benefits, giving users unparalleled control and customization over their smartphones or tablets. While the process may seem daunting to some, the advantages it brings can greatly enhance the user experience and unlock the full potential of the operating system.

In this article, we will explore the various benefits of rooting Android devices and discuss the different methods available for rooting based on the Android version.

1- Increased Customization and Personalization

One of the primary reasons individuals choose to root their Android devices is to gain more control over the appearance and functionality of their phones or tablets. By rooting, users can access and modify system files and settings that are typically off-limits on unrooted devices.

This allows for a higher level of customization, such as installing custom ROMs or themes, changing the system fonts, and even enabling additional gestures or features.

2- Improved Performance and Battery Life

Rooting can also lead to improved performance and battery life for Android devices. With root access, users can uninstall bloatware, which are pre-installed applications that consume valuable system resources.

By removing these unwanted apps, users can free up storage space, RAM, and CPU usage, resulting in a smoother and faster device performance.

Additionally, certain root-only applications, such as Greenify, can help optimize battery usage and extend the battery life of the device.

3- Access to Exclusive Apps and Features

Rooting an Android device grants users access to a whole new realm of exclusive apps and features. Various applications and tools, specifically designed for rooted devices, offer functionality and capabilities that are not available to unrooted users.

These apps range from powerful backup and restore tools to ad-blockers, file explorers with root access, and even advanced firewall configurations.

Rooting enables users to leverage the full potential of these apps and take advantage of features not accessible to non-rooted devices.

4- Advanced Backup and Restoration

Another significant benefit of rooting is the ability to perform advanced backup and restoration operations. Root-only apps like Titanium Backup allow users to back up entire system configurations, app data, and settings.

This level of backup granularity ensures that even after a system update or device reset, users can easily restore their personalized settings, app data, and configurations without any hassle.

Such advanced backup and restoration functionalities are indispensable for power users and individuals who frequently switch devices.

5- Enhanced System Tweaks and Modifications

Rooting Android provides users with the freedom to tweak and modify various aspects of the operating system. This includes overclocking or underclocking the CPU to adjust performance, re-partitioning the device's internal storage, and modifying system files to customize app behavior.

These system-level modifications allow users to tailor their Android experience to their liking, granting them complete control over their device's hardware and software settings.

6- Access to Latest Android Updates

also provide access to the latest Android updates. While official updates may take time to reach certain devices, custom ROMs developed by the Android community often offer the latest operating system versions well before the official release.

This enables users to enjoy the latest features and security updates introduced by Google, ensuring their devices stay up to date.

However, it is important to note that installing custom ROMs requires technical knowledge and may void the device's warranty.

Rooting Methods for Different Android Versions

Rooting methods can vary depending on the Android version installed on the device. It is crucial to understand the specific rooting techniques that correspond to different Android versions, as using incorrect methods can potentially brick the device or cause other issues. Below, we discuss the rooting methods commonly used for various Android versions.

Android 10 and Above

For Android 10 and newer versions 11/12/13, the most popular method to root is through Magisk, a powerful and flexible root utility.

Magisk provides systemless root access, which allows users to root their devices without modifying the system partition. This method preserves the integrity of the device's system and enables root access while still passing the SafetyNet integrity check, a security measure used by certain applications.

Android 9 Pie

Android 9 Pie introduced a new security feature called "system-as-root," which changed the traditional root method. To root devices running Android 9 Pie, users can utilize tools like Magisk or SuperSU. These tools provide options for systemless rooting or patching the boot image, allowing users to modify the system files and gain full control over the device.

Android 8 Oreo

Rooting Android 8 Oreo typically involves using third-party applications like Magisk or SuperSU. These tools enable users to flash the Superuser binary onto the device, granting root access. However, it is important to note that the exact steps and compatibility may vary depending on the specific device model and manufacturer.

Android 7 Nougat

For Android 7 Nougat, rooting methods often require unlocking the device's bootloader, followed by flashing a custom recovery, such as TWRP (Team Win Recovery Project). Once the custom recovery is installed, users can then flash a suitable root package, granting root access to the device.


Rooting an Android device can provide aspiring power users with an array of benefits, including increased customization, improved performance, and access to exclusive features.

However, it is crucial to proceed with caution and thoroughly research the rooting process before attempting it, as improper rooting can lead to adverse effects, including voiding the device's warranty or bricking the device.

Additionally, it is essential to choose a suitable rooting method based on the Android version installed on the device, ensuring compatibility and minimizing potential risks.

Share this post

Adnan Al Nemrawi

AuthorAdnan Al Nemrawi

You may like these posts

Post a Comment